Guwahati vs Choluteca Climate & Distance Between

Honduras flag
  • The distance between Guwahati, India and Choluteca, Honduras is approximately 15,630 km or 9,713 mi.
  • To reach Guwahati in this distance one would set out from Choluteca bearing 1.8° or N and follow the great circles arc to approach Guwahati bearing 178.1° or S .
  • Guwahati has a humid subtropical climate with dry winters (Cwa) whereas Choluteca has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w).
  • Guwahati is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ome whereas Choluteca is in or near the subtropical dry forest biome.
  • The average temperature is 4.5 °C (8.1°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 8.6 °C (15.5°F) more in Guwahati.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to truly hyperoce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 18.8 mm (0.7 in) more which is equivalent to 18.8 l/m² (0.46 US gal/ft²) or 188,000 l/ha (20,098 US gal/ac) more. About 1 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 8.6° lower in Guwahati than in Choluteca.
